Output 19df163150e0c92c988e18bc1ea6ee8deef3bf7f253a9d5fa1d943f2631127d3:3

value
84624970
script pubkey
OP_0 OP_PUSHBYTES_20 23442efc59ae68d3a4ac902e8752cdf2c3f6590c
address
ltc1qydzzalze4e5d8f9vjqhgw5kd7tplvkgvhp450a
transaction
19df163150e0c92c988e18bc1ea6ee8deef3bf7f253a9d5fa1d943f2631127d3
spent
true